Christian Community House
Early Christian gathering places that were typically private homes repurposed for worship and community functions before church buildings became common.
Dura-Europos
Dura-Europos was an ancient Hellenistic, Parthian, and Roman border city located in present-day Syria, known for its well-preserved ruins that offer insights into early Christian, Jewish, and Pagan communities.
